    • @ThatModelRailwayGuy
      @ThatModelRailwayGuy  3 роки тому +1

      Hey Adi, usually the traction tyres are added because the manufacturer feels the loco hasn't got enough power to pull a train behind it. Even with the metal boiler the D Class still feels like the weight isn't fully over the driving wheels to me so I can see why Dapol went for this. At least they've given us the option of removing the traction tyres if we want which isn't always the case with other models. Thanks for watching 😃
